An exciting two-bedroom Warner flat, seconds from the vibrant Lloyd Park.
This delightful home, is set on the ground floor and offers a harmonious blend of comfort, convenience, and outdoor space, making it an ideal home for couples, small families, or those seeking a tranquil living experience. You enter through your own private entrance and are greeted with slick wooden flooring throughout and the bright an airy living area immediately as you enter. The flexibility of this homes means you could flip it's layout and have the lounge to the rear as well. The separate kitchen design not only ensures privacy but also offers easy access to the shared rear garden, ideal to chill in those summer evenings and being fully paved makes maintenance stress free.
The flat boasts two generously sized bedrooms that provide ample space to unwind and create your personal haven. Both bedrooms are thoughtfully designed with abundant natural light, ensuring a pleasant ambiance throughout the day. Adjacent to the bedrooms is a stylish and well-equipped family bathroom. Further benefits include; gas central heating, double glazed windows throughout, bright and spacious rooms, wooden flooring and plenty of storage.
Explore
Winns Terrace is widely regarded as one of the best Warner built property roads, mainly due to its close proximity to Lloyd Park but also the access to great transport links and schools. The entrance to the park is literally a stone’s throw away paving a gateway to this fantastic open green space that is also home to the famous William Morris Gallery. There is plenty to do here for all the family - whether it be exploring the listed Georgian museum itself, enjoying the greenery and nature of the gardens, trying your hand on the tennis or basketball courts, or treating yourself to some of the amazing street food on offer at the weekends. If shopping is more your thing, you have an awesome selection of independent and more recognised high street brands at the The Mall by Walthamstow Central. The Bell will be your new local pub, which is just a few minutes walk, as well as Buhler and Co and Wynwood which will both satisfy an urge for decent coffee. Transport links here are also fantastic with Walthamstow Central and Blackhorse Road conveniently accessible, providing both Victoria Line tube and Overground Trains into the City in around 20 minutes.
